I agree that didynium lenses are nice, especially with silver where they help highlight the very first pale red when the joint is up to temperature. I still found the gasflux flame too bright with didynium, and used No. 3 green lens.
And sodium produces a yellow flame. It's the boron in the boric acid flux that produces the characteristic green flame:
